Course Content

  • • Energy Management and Efficiency in Smart Cities
  • • Renewable Energy Technologies for Urban Environments
  • • Smart Grids and Microgrids for Sustainable Energy Systems
  • • Energy Storage Solutions for Smart Cities
  • • Sustainable Transportation Systems and Electric Vehicles
  • • Policy and Regulation in Sustainable Energy for Urban Areas
  • • Data Analytics and IoT Applications in Smart Energy Systems
  • • Resilience and Security in Smart City Energy Infrastructure
  • • Integration of Distributed Energy Resources in Urban Settings
  • • Case Studies and Best Practices in Sustainable Energy for Smart Cities
